A GREAT HONOR
 
“Whoever finds his life will lose it, and whoever loses his life for my sake will find it.” – Matthew 10:39
 
Corrie Ten Boom was a Dutch watchmaker who helped save the lives of Jews by hiding them in their home during the Nazi occupation of Holland. Unfortunately, Corrie and her family were arrested by the Gestapo in 1944. Corrie and her sister Betsie were imprisoned in Ravensbruck. It seemed to be the end of the family’s mission but it was where the mission was continued with much fervor. Corrie and Betsie held worship services attended by Catholic, Lutheran and Eastern Orthodox women prisoners. Even behind bars, Corrie reached out, risked her life and gave hope to those in need of it as much as she did.
I believe that the Lord honored Corrie’s willingness to give up her life for others by saving her. Thanks to a clerical error, Corrie was released from Ravensbruck a week before all the women prisoners her age were killed. The Lord preserved Corrie’s life that she may continue her mission and share with the world what she learned from her imprisonment. As her sister Betsie exhorted Corrie, “We must tell them what we have learned here. We must tell them that there is no pit so deep that He is not deeper still. They will listen to us, Corrie, because we have been here.”Dina Pecaña (dpecana@yahoo.com)

1st READING
 
 “The more they were oppressed, the more they multiplied and spread.” Although the evil seeks to thwart the work and purpose of God and His people, all his efforts are in vain and are ultimately used by God to bless and increase His Kingdom.
 
Exodus 1:8-14, 22
8 A new king, who knew nothing of Joseph, came to power in Egypt. 9 He said to his subjects, “Look how numerous and powerful the people of the children of Israel are growing, more so than we ourselves! 10 Come, let us deal shrewdly with them to stop their increase; otherwise, in time of war they too may join our enemies to fight against us, and so leave our country.” 11 Accordingly, taskmasters were set over the Israelites to oppress them with forced labor. Thus they had to build for Pharaoh the supply cities of Pithom and Raamses. 12 Yet the more they were oppressed, the more they multiplied and spread. The Egyptians, then, dreaded the children of Israel 13 and reduced them to cruel slavery, 14 making life bitter for them with hard work in mortar and brick and all kinds of field work — the whole cruel fate of slaves. 22 Pharaoh then commanded all his subjects, “Throw into the river every boy that is born to the Hebrews, but you may let all the girls live.”
 
P S A L M
 
Psalms 124:1-3, 4-6, 7-8
R: Our help is in the name of the Lord.
1 Had not the LORD been with us — let Israel say, 2 had not the LORD been with us — when men rose up against us, 3 then would they have swallowed us alive. When their fury was inflamed against us. (R) 4 Then would the waters have overwhelmed us; the torrent would have swept over us; 5 over us then would have swept the raging waters. 6 Blessed be the LORD, who did not leave us a prey to their teeth. (R) 7 We were rescued like a bird from the fowlers’ snare; broken was the snare, and we were freed. 8 Our help is in the name of the LORD, who made heaven and earth. (R)
 
G O S P E L
 
Jesus wants His disciples to have a realistic view of what it will mean to truly follow Him. It will inevitably cause conflicts even with those closest to us. If we choose to put God first in our lives, far from harming our families, it will ultimately be for their good and blessing.
 
ALLELUIA
R: Alleluia, alleluia
Blessed are they who are persecuted for the sake of righteousness for theirs is the Kingdom of heaven.
R: Alleluia, alleluia
 
Matthew 10:34-11:1
34 Jesus said to his Apostles: “Do not think that I have come to bring peace upon the earth. I have come to bring not peace but the sword. 35 For I have come to set a man ‘against his father, a daughter against her mother, and a daughter-in-law against her mother-in-law; 36 and one’s enemies will be those of his household.’ 37 Whoever loves father or mother more than me is not worthy of me, and whoever loves son or daughter more than me is not worthy of me; 38 and whoever does not take up his cross and follow after me is not worthy of me. 39 Whoever finds his life will lose it, and whoever loses his life for my sake will find it. 40 Whoever receives you receives me, and whoever receives me receives the one who sent me. 41 Whoever receives a prophet because he is a prophet will receive a prophet’s reward,  and whoever receives a righteous man because he is righteous will receive a righteous man’s reward. 42 And whoever gives only a cup of cold water to one of these little ones to drink because he is a disciple — amen, I say to you, he will surely not lose his reward.” 11: 1 When Jesus finished giving these commands to his twelve disciples, he went away from that place to teach and to preach in their towns.

A Crash Course on Family Renewal
 
For couples who have gone through the Marriage Encounter Weekend (MEW), a follow-through growth program is the Family Encounter Weekend (FEW). The FEW teaches fathers, mothers and their children the good fruits of openness and continuing dialogue, especially if carried out in the spirit of non-judgemental expression and acceptance of felt needs and emotions. During the talks, reflections and exercises during the weekend, fathers and mothers experience the reality that their children could actually be their great enemies and burdens in life, as the words of Jesus today reveal. Even practical human wisdom says that we are often hurt most deeply by those closest to us.
The progress of the Family Encounter, however, opens us to liberating lessons that are parallel to today’s Gospel:
Jesus says, “Those who try to gain their own life will lose it.” The more someone insists that family members satisfy his wants and expectations, the more he loses the beauty of family life.
Jesus says, “Those who love their father or mother, or their son or daughter, more than me... are not fit.” Loving our family members too tightly can actually be a self-centered, selfish, possessive and manipulative way of loving. Family  members will surely resent this.
Jesus says, “Those who do not take up their cross... are not fit.” The cross of Jesus is a symbol of love that is willing to sacrifice beyond what is fair to reach out and save others. This is what the family needs: that each member does not simply relate with one another justly, like a 50-50 sharing, but that each one should be willing to fill up the gaps of another— up to a hundred percent.
Jesus finally shares, “Whoever welcomes me welcomes the one who sent me — God.” True family renewal happens when each member of the family begins to relate, to feel, to think, to act, to love in the pattern of true faith in God. There can be no truly human and humane values without religion and faith. Fr. Domie Guzman, SSP
